Three inspections in three months
The action of our story takes place in Reims and begins on October 8. The police detained A Peugeot 307 the driver of which drives without a seat belt. After a chase, he was caught and tested positive for cannabis. Another concern is that he doesn’t have a driver’s license because it was suspended in January for the same reason. After his release, he was caught again in November for running a red light. He still is under the influence of drugs but released. He was finally caught again on December 7, but this time he wasn’t going to face it.
Prison term
According to the prosecutor’s office, the driver was quickly convicted. He received 1 penalty1 month of imprisonment, five of which are on probation. This also includes an obligation to take road safety courses, as well as an obligation to work and care. The driver will be on an electronic bracelet and will serve his sentence at home.
